D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the respondent, inter alia, to dismiss an app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Queens County, dated August 12, 2015, on the ground that no appeal lies from an order entered upon the default of an appealing party. Application by the respondent pursuant to 22 NYCRR 670.8(d)(2) to enlarge the time to serve and file a brief.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, and upon the papers filed in support of the application and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is to dismiss the appeal is granted, and the appeal is dismissed, without costs or disbursements (see CPLR 5511); and it is further,

ORDERED that the motion is otherwise denied as academic; and it is further,

ORDERED that the application is denied as academic.
